Violet Represents Modernity and Elegance
Purple is a blend of two intense colours: red and blue. It gives interiors character, maturity, and style. Purple is increasingly popular in interiors, used not only as an accent but also as a base colour, for example on walls. It is an energetic colour that stimulates creativity and enhances the sense of humour. At the same time, it soothes the brain, calms, and helps regenerate the nervous system.
A bright shade of purple, lavender, adds a touch of romance and brings subtlety and delicacy to a space. Deep and dark shades such as plum or dark purple are associated with wealth and pair beautifully with gold and silver accessories. This combination creates a mysterious and very elegant interior.
Violet blends perfectly with dark colours like browns, greys, or deep reds. It is also worth combining with lighter shades such as grey, beige, or white. Purple is often used in the Provencal style, where lavender is dominant. It can be applied to walls, furniture, or accessories. It works well in classic interiors, adding sophistication and elegance. Thanks to its wide palette, violet can be adapted to any interior style and the tastes of its residents.
